  • Patent number: 4839109
    Abstract: A mixture of a specified siloxanylalkyl ester monomer and a specified vinyl monomer is polymerized by exposure to an ionizing radiation at low temperatures and the resulting polymer is worked with a lathe cut to form a contact lens. The contact lens obtained is free from any optical distortion, has good dimensional stability and exhibits high oxygen permeability. In a preferred embodiment, a monomer mixture comprising a siloxanylalkyl ester, a methacrylate or acrylate, N-vinylpyrrolidone, and a small amount of a dimethacrylate or diacrylate is exposed to a total dose of 1.times.10.sup.5 -5.times.10.sup.6 roentgens at a low temperature (-80.degree. C. to -20.degree. C. and at a dose rate of 8.times.10.sup.4 -2.times.10.sup.6 roentgens per hour, and the resulting polymer is worked into a contact lens by a suitable forming process involving cutting, grinding and polishing operations.

  • Patent number: 3988392
    Abstract: There is provided a polymer composition consisting essentially of 95-50 wt% of a methyl methacrylate homopolymer or copolymer component and 5-50 wt% of a cross-linked elastomer obtained by copolymerizing a mixture of stated amounts of (I) alkyl acrylate, (II) allyl acrylate and/or allyl methacrylate and (III) benzyl acrylate, the elastomer having a stated average particle size and a stated extent of cross-linking. The polymer composition comprises (1) a graft copolymer obtained by polymerizing methyl methacrylate or its mixture in the presence of the above elastomer; or (2) a blend of the above graft copolymer and a methyl methacrylate homopolymer or copolymer. The polymer composition provides shaped articles exhibiting good transparency over a broad range of temperature as well as good weather resistance and impact resistance.

  • Patent number: 3978178
    Abstract: An improvement in a process for producing a synthetic resin cast article having an abrasion-resistant polymer surface layer integrated with the polymer body is provided. The improvement is characterized in that the abrasion-resistant polymer surface layer is formed by a two step polymerization procedure; in the first polymerization step, the polymerizable material is covered with a covering body such as a polymer film, closely adhered thereto, and in the second polymerization step, the polymerizable material is exposed to the air.
